Understanding Gold IRA Rollovers: A Comprehensive Guide
In recent years, gold has regained its status as a popular investment option, particularly among those looking to diversify their retirement portfolios. One of the most effective ways to invest in gold within a retirement account is through a Gold IRA rollover. This report aims to provide a comprehensive overview of what a Gold IRA rollover is, its benefits, the process involved, and important considerations for investors.
What is a Gold IRA Rollover?
A Gold IRA rollover involves transferring funds from an existing retirement account, such as a traditional IRA or 401(k), into a Gold IRA. A Gold IRA is a self-directed individual retirement account that allows investors to hold physical gold bullion, coins, and other precious metals as part of their retirement savings. This type of investment provides an opportunity to hedge against inflation and market volatility, as gold often retains its value even during economic downturns.
Benefits of a Gold IRA Rollover
Diversification: One of the primary benefits of a Gold IRA rollover is the diversification it brings to an investment portfolio. By including gold, investors can reduce their overall risk, as gold often behaves differently than stocks and bonds.
Protection Against Inflation: Gold has historically been viewed as a safe haven asset. During periods of high inflation, the value of currency tends to decline, but gold often retains its purchasing power, making it an effective hedge against inflation.
Tax Advantages: A Gold IRA rollover can provide tax benefits similar to those of traditional IRAs. Contributions may be tax-deductible, and the growth of investments within the IRA is tax-deferred until withdrawal.
